Chinese startup DeepSeek disrupts US AI market with cost-effective model
Chinese start-up DeepSeek has launched its AI model R1, which rivals US applications like ChatGPT at a fraction of the cost, causing significant market shifts. Despite US trade restrictions, DeepSeek claims to have trained R1 using only 2,000 Nvidia chips, raising questions about the future of AI investments and US dominance in the sector. The model's success has led to a sharp decline in Nvidia's stock and has prompted concerns over the viability of data center investments, as well as potential political tensions between the US and China.
